This chemical is called Morpholine, 2,6-dimethyl-4-(2-oxiranylmethyl)-, and its systematic name is 2,6-dimethyl-4-(oxiran-2-ylmethyl)morpholine. With the molecular formula of C9H17NO2, its molecular weight is 171.24. The CAS registry number of this chemical is 90950-33-7.
Other characteristics of the Morpholine, 2,6-dimethyl-4-(2-oxiranylmethyl)- can be summarised as followings: (1)ACD/LogP: 0.65; (2)# of Rule of 5 Violations: 0; (3)#H bond acceptors: 3; (4)#H bond donors: 0; (5)#Freely Rotating Bonds: 2; (6)Polar Surface Area: 25 Å2; (7)Index of Refraction: 1.471; (8)Molar Refractivity: 46.55 cm3; (9)Molar Volume: 166.4 cm3; (10)Polarizability: 18.45×10-24cm3; (11)Surface Tension: 30.8 dyne/cm; (12)Density: 1.028 g/cm3; (13)Flash Point: 81.3 °C; (14)Enthalpy of Vaporization: 46.68 kJ/mol; (15)Boiling Point: 230.1 °C at 760 mmHg; (16)Vapour Pressure: 0.0669 mmHg at 25°C.
Uses of this chemical: The Morpholine, 2,6-dimethyl-4-(2-oxiranylmethyl)- could react with carbamonitrile; sodium-salt, and obtain the 5-(2,6-dimethyl-morpholin-4-ylmethyl)-4,5-dihydro-oxazol-2-ylamine. This reaction needs the solvent of methanol. The yield is 48 %. In addition, this reaction should be taken for 15 hours at the temperature of 20 °C.
